Rawlas - Khategaon, Dewas
Rawlas is a village situated in the Khategaon tehsil of Dewas district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 28 km from the tehsil headquarters in Khategaon and around 150 km from the district headquarters in Dewas. Mailpiplya serves as the Gram Panchayat for Rawlas village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Rawlas is 474300. The village covers a total geographical area of 417.01 hectares and falls under the 455336 pincode. Harda is the nearest town, located about 28 km away.
Rawlas village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Rawlas
As per Census 2011, Rawlas village has a total population of 486 people, consisting of 248 males and 238 females. The village has 131 households and a sex ratio of 959 females per 1,000 males. There are 85 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 261 literate and 225 illiterate residents. Additionally, 127 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Rawlas are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 486 | 248 | 238 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 85 | 46 | 39 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 127 | 67 | 60 |
| Literate Population | 261 | 151 | 110 |
| Illiterate Population | 225 | 97 | 128 |

Transport and Connectivity of Rawlas
Rawlas is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Bhiringi, while the nearest airport is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 86.1 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Harda to Rawlas is about 28 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Dewas to Rawlas is about 150 km, with the usual travel time around ~4.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
